Technical Specifications
| Specification | Detail |
|---|---|
| Primary Material | Stainless Steel Frame, 600D Oxford Fabric |
| Available Sizes (LxWxH) | 5.5×2.5×2.3m, 5.9×2.5×2.45m, 5.9×2.7×2.45m, 6×2.5×2.5m, 6×2.7×2.5m, 6.4×2.8×2.65m |
| Weight (Approx.) | 60 kg (Total Package) |
| Load Capacity | Up to 300 kg |
| Key Features | Semi-Automatic, Waterproof, UV-Resistant, Windproof, Tear-Resistant |
| Applicable Vehicles | Sedans, SUVs, Pickup Trucks, Motorcycles, Small RVs |

How to Use Stainless Steel Carport, Heavy Duty Mobile Carport, Foldable Retractable Car Awning, Semi-Automatic Durable Shelter, All-Weather Weatherproof RV Cover: Complete Guide

Step 1: Initial Setup and Installation
1. Choose Your Location: Select a flat, stable surface. Clear any debris or sharp objects. Consider water runoff direction.
2. Lay Out Components: Unpack all parts. Identify the main frame sections, canopy, and hardware bag.
3. Assemble the Frame: Connect the pre-formed stainless steel sections as per the manual. This usually involves sliding poles together and securing them with provided pins or bolts. Having a second person is highly recommended.
4. Attach the Canopy: Drape the Oxford fabric over the assembled frame. Secure it to the frame using the attached straps, buckles, or hook-and-loop fasteners at multiple points. Ensure it’s evenly tensioned.
Step 2: First-Time User Guide
Once assembled, the semi-automatic function is straightforward. To deploy, simply unlock the mechanism (often a pull-pin or latch) and gently push the roof outward along its tracks until it clicks into the fully open position. Ensure all locking points are engaged. To retract, reverse the process. Familiarize yourself with the locking points before placing your vehicle underneath.
Step 3: Core Functions and Daily Use
Daily use is simple. Park your car under the extended canopy. The semi-automatic design means you can open or close it in under a minute, making it easy to access the shelter only when needed. For optimal performance, ensure the fabric remains taut to prevent water pooling.
Step 4: Advanced Techniques
For maximum wind resistance, always use the included ground stakes or augers, especially if you’re not on concrete. In snowy regions, periodically brush heavy, wet snow off the canopy to prevent excessive load, even though it’s rated for it. This is a key practice for any heavy duty car awning worth buying.
Step 5: Maintenance and Care
Regularly clean the canopy with mild soap and water to prevent mold and mildew. Inspect the stainless steel frame for any debris in the tracks and lubricate moving parts with a silicone-based lubricant annually. When folding for long-term storage, ensure the fabric is completely dry to prevent mildew. For more detailed care, see our outdoor shelter maintenance guide.
Step 6: Troubleshooting Common Issues
Issue: Canopy sags or pools water. Solution: Retension the fabric straps evenly across all attachment points.
Issue: Frame feels loose or wobbly. Solution: Check all connection bolts and pins are tight and that the unit is on level ground with stakes secured.
Issue: Mechanism is stiff. Solution: Clean the tracks and apply lubricant. Never force it. If problems persist, contact the seller via the product page for support.

Expert Tips for Maximum Value
Tip #1: Site Preparation is Key
Don’t skimp on preparing a level base. Use crushed gravel or concrete pavers for optimal stability and drainage. This extends the life of both the frame and fabric.
Tip #2: Proactive Wind Management
Always use the ground stakes, even on calm days. For extra security in high-wind zones, consider adding additional ratchet straps to anchor the frame to ground screws or a concrete slab.
Tip #3: Seasonal Fabric Care
At the end of each season, give the canopy a thorough clean and let it dry completely before folding. Store it in a dry place to prevent mildew and fabric degradation.
Tip #4: Lubricate Moving Parts Annually
A simple application of silicone spray on the sliding tracks and locking mechanisms once a year will keep the semi-automatic operation smooth and prevent wear.
Tip #5: Consider a Complementary Floor
Pairing the shelter with a heavy-duty outdoor mat or interlocking plastic tiles creates a clean, finished look and prevents mud or gravel from being tracked into your car.
Tip #6: Document Your Setup
Take photos during assembly, especially of the bolt configurations. This will save immense time and frustration if you need to disassemble and move it later.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
- Mistake: Installing on uneven or soft ground. → Solution: Always level the site and compact the soil or use a solid base.
- Mistake: Not securing it for high winds. → Solution: Use all provided anchors. In storms, consider temporarily lowering the canopy if safe to do so.
- Mistake: Allowing leaves/debris to accumulate on the roof. → Solution: Regularly sweep the canopy to prevent water pooling and fabric stress.
- Mistake: Forcing the semi-automatic mechanism. → Solution: If it sticks, check for obstructions in the tracks and lubricate. Forcing it can bend the frame.
- Mistake: Storing the canopy while wet. → Solution: Always ensure it is bone-dry before folding and storing to prevent irreversible mildew damage.

How does it compare to a permanent metal carport?
The key difference is portability versus permanence. A permanent metal carport is typically more affordable for the size, can withstand slightly higher snow/wind loads when properly installed, and requires no maintenance. This foldable model offers similar daily protection but can be moved or removed, doesn’t require a building permit in most areas, and has a semi-automatic function. It’s a trade-off between ultimate fixed strength and flexible convenience.
